Transaction e46380ef1cf6f36651a875da3e40aeec3b68f527b97a677dd214a89c58e705f6

block
5270cc1111a17fc7f0c0e3da14861780868b0bc939d1f7f7beed86bf1084d6ac

1 Input

15 Outputs